Posted by: wolffie

hey guys, my buddy who has an 04 450r wants to get a pipe. right now he is all stock (with the exception of a K@N) and is looking for an all around performance pipe. he doesnt race in a league or anything, but he favors the low and mid range style racing of MX or XC (top end isnt a huge priority)

with that said, he isnt looking to bust his wallet either. i dont have much experience with pipes for the 450r, but these seem to to be the top 3 choices. what do you guys think would be the best pipe overall (performance, cost, looks) i know i can get the HMF shipped to his house for $215! how much do the other pipes cost, and would he be better off saving his money up to get them? thanks! sorry for being so lenghty!!!



Posted by: MAD450r

Sparks doesnt make a slipon. I have seen the sparks for like 450-500$

If I were to do it again I might try the rossier, but I love my sparks besides all the noise.

Posted by: K-Dub

I have a Rossier on my 04. I had the stock pipe with the HRC kit and had to run a 13 tooth front sproket. Once I put the Rossier on it the bike came alive and I had to go back to the 14.
